  • Fertility Struggles and Raising a Donor-Conceived Child
    2024/04/17

    When Joe and his wife embarked on their dream to become parents, they never imagined the hurdles they would face. Today, Joe shares his intimate tale of overcoming male infertility, including a raw look at his genetic condition and the emotional landscape he navigated. Together, we follow their path from the shock of diagnosis to the joyous laughter of their eight-and-a-half-month-old daughter, Ellie. It's an honest reflection on the hardships of starting a family and the resilience required to keep moving forward.

    Navigating the often-overlooked issue of male infertility, our conversation uncovers the complex process Joe and his wife underwent when considering sperm donation. Joe candidly discusses the inner turmoil of choosing between known and anonymous donors, and the impact of these decisions on their future child's life. We also delve into the rare specialty clinics that cater to male infertility and the logistical intricacies involved once a donor is on board. Joe's story is a testament to the perseverance of the human spirit, providing solace and understanding to those facing similar battles.

    As we wrap up our heart-to-heart with Joe, we're reminded that the journey doesn't end at conception. Raising a donor-conceived child comes with its unique set of experiences, and Joe opens up about fostering an environment of openness and honesty. Highlighting resources like the book "Three Makes Baby," we underscore the significance of including a donor in a child's life narrative. It's a celebration of the shift towards sharing these once-private stories, the embrace of a supportive community, and the camaraderie among parents in the dad bod community. Joe's experience offers a beacon of hope and empowerment for those charting their own courses through the joys and challenges of modern parenting.

  • School Lunchbox - Cracking the code with George Georgievski.
    2024/04/10

    Picture the chaos of parenting: early mornings, runny noses, and the mystical quest for the 'Husband Handbook'. George from School Lunchbox joins me to swap tales from the trenches of fatherhood, where we share a laugh over the universal dad experience of sticker-shock and the unexpected delights of Easter egg hunts. With a candid look at the transition from professional life to the hands-on day-to-day of parenting two girls, this episode is a reminder that in the midst of family mayhem, there's a community of fathers embracing the ride.

    Feeding kids can feel like navigating a labyrinth of nutritional do's and don'ts, but we've cooked up a strategy as simple as it is colorful. I lay out my 'number five' rule—two fruits and three veggies—while George and I swap tips on making meal prep a playful affair. From sandwich shapes that spark joy to a palette of flavors that would impress a seasoned traveler, we serve up advice on keeping both the lunchbox and your little ones lively and diversified.

    Morning routines can signal the start of a dreaded daily grind, but what if they became a ritual for bonding and well-being? I share how my early rise and weekend prep transform mornings from frenzied to fruitful, setting the tone for a day where even self-care finds space on the to-do list. We wrap up by blending work, family life, and the careful curation of social media, offering up a taste of how to keep it all in balance—hint: sometimes your best tool is the smartphone in your pocket. Join us as we celebrate the wins, weather the challenges, and most importantly, stay grounded in what matters most in this parenting journey.

  • Harley Clifford - From World Champ to Rad Dad
    2024/04/04

    Hey fellow dads and sports enthusiasts, Kyle Graham here—your chief navigator through the wild journey of fatherhood, with a side of high-flying sports action. Today's DadBodcast episode is one for the books as we sit down with the legendary wakeboarder Harley Clifford. Imagine having your life flipped upside down by the pitter-patter of little feet; that's exactly what happened to Harley as he shares his shift from wakeboarding fame to the adventures of daddy duty. Expect tales of Easter egg hunts with a twist and how his own childhood escapades in Medowie paved the way for a family steeped in the love of sports.

    Get ready to ride the wave of emotions as we tackle the ups and downs of a champion's life. We cover Harley's breathtaking journey from clinching his first world title at the tender age of 14 to grappling with the physical and emotional tolls of injuries. Harley gets real about the pressures of international competition, the sweet taste of victory, and the behind-the-scenes effort it takes to maintain a top spot in the wakeboarding world. But it's not all smooth sailing; we also delve into how marriage and the arrival of his daughter Elodie amidst a global pandemic brought new challenges and profound changes to Harley's life trajectory.

    As we wrap up the session, we get an honest look into the Clifford household's laughter-filled chaos. From the comedic trials of bedtime routines to the surprising contemplation of adding another munchkin to the mix, Harley's life is a lesson in adaptation and growth. He doesn't shy away from discussing the anxieties that come with hanging up the competitive wakeboard for a more grounded family life, and the steps he's taking to navigate the tides of change. So, buckle up and join us for this heart-to-heart that's as thrilling as it is relatable, because whether you're shredding waves or changing diapers, we're all in this ride together.
